Acesso em:.http://bdm.ufpa.br/jspui/handle/prefix/2016The tertiary and quaternary sediments of the region between the mouth of the Rio Araguari and Belts Lacustres in the state of Amapá, comprising sands, silty sands, silts and sandy silts. Mineralogically consist of quartz (56%), muscovite (18%), albite (6%), K-feldspar (trace) and clay as well as oxides and hydroxides of iron and heavy mineral transparent and opaque. The clay minerals are composed of smectite (53%), kaolinite (33%) and illite (14%), and chlorite in trace amounts. Among the transparent heavy minerals were identified 13 distinct species, represented by three major associations: assemblies A (epidote-hornblende-hypersthene-diopside-garnet) and B (epidote-zircon-hornblende-tourmaline) correspond to the fine sediments of Quaternary and indicate influence of source area of predominantly mafic-ultramafic composition and also felsic igneous and sedimentary; the content of the assembly C (zircon-epidote-tourmaline-staurolite-hornblende), referring to the coarser sediments of Tertiary indicates influences by source area of mainly felsic composition, as well as sedimentary rocks, mafic and yet so secondary. CIA values show that both tertiary sediments (> 90) as the quaternary (75-85) were affected by high weathering conditions, being more pronounced in the samples of Quaternary. The depletion in La, Th, Sc and Hf, and higher content of Co in the Quaternary sediments reflects the high concentration of ferromagnesian minerals (assemblies A and B) and its derivation from rocks of the Andes and sediment Solimões Basin. Tertiary samples, however, have more enriched composition of La, Th, Hf and Zr, indicating abundant mineral ltraestables (assembly C), as well as derivation from felsic more sources of Precambrian Shield sand recycled sediments from the Amazon Basin, mixed in various proportions.
